Overview of the AUB Mastercard Foundation Scholarship 2026
The AUB Mastercard Foundation Scholarship is designed for ambitious African students pursuing postgraduate and PhD studies at the American University of Beirut. Sponsored by the Mastercard Foundation, it aims to develop leaders equipped with knowledge, skills, and experience to address challenges in their home countries and contribute positively to the continent’s development.
The program is more than a financial aid package. Scholars participate in leadership workshops, mentoring, tutoring, and internship programs, ensuring holistic personal and professional growth alongside academic excellence.
Key Features of the Scholarship
- Host: American University of Beirut in partnership with Mastercard Foundation
- Study Destination: Beirut, Lebanon (Asia)
- Eligible Candidates: Citizens or refugees residing in African countries
- Fields: Postgraduate and PhD programs
- Coverage: Full tuition, accommodation, monthly stipend, laptop, travel, visa, books, and medical insurance
- Deadline: November 6, 2025
- Additional Benefits: Leadership development, mentoring, internships, tutoring
- Age Limit: 35 years or younger

Who Should Apply? Eligibility Criteria
Applicants must meet the following requirements:
- Be a citizen or refugee residing in an African country
- Show good academic standing from previous degree(s)
- Demonstrate talents that exceed financial capacities
- Exhibit a commitment to community and regional development
- Possess strong leadership qualities and readiness to engage in workshops
- Be 35 years or below at the time of application
- Proof of English proficiency via TOEFL IBT, IELTS Academic, GRE Verbal, GMAT Verbal, or DUOLINGO English Test (DET)
- Commitment to participate in all program activities including leadership training and fieldwork

How to Apply for the AUB Mastercard Scholarship 2026: Step-by-Step Guide
- Submit AUB Graduate Application: Begin by completing the AUB online graduate application and upload all necessary documents before the deadline.
- Select Mastercard Foundation Scholars Program: During application, select this financial opportunity under the “Financial Opportunities” section.
- Complete Financial Aid Application: Within 1-3 business days after submitting your graduate application, you will receive an email allowing you to complete the AUB Financial Aid Application.
- Submit English Proficiency Scores: Make sure to include your RUSE (Readiness for University Studies in English) test scores as part of your application package.
- Ensure Your Application Is Complete: Confirm that you have submitted:
- The AUB graduate application
- Mastercard Foundation Scholars Program survey
- English proficiency test scores
